The first step in marketing for embroidery clients is to understand who your target audience is. This includes businesses in the promotional industry, corporate gift suppliers, and local embroidery shops. Each of these segments has different needs and expectations. For instance, promotional companies might be looking for bulk orders with quick turnaround times, while local shops might focus on quality and customization. By identifying the specific needs of each segment, you can tailor your marketing messages to resonate with them.

In today's digital age, leveraging online platforms is crucial for reaching embroidery clients. This includes maintaining an active presence on social media platforms like Instagram and Pinterest, where visual content thrives. Sharing high-quality images of your work can attract potential clients and showcase your craftsmanship. Additionally, investing in SEO strategies to improve your website's visibility can help attract organic traffic from search engines. Using keywords such as "embroidery digitizing services" and "custom embroidery" can enhance your online presence and draw in clients searching for these services.
